<br />~ RANGEWIDE CONSERVATION AGREEMENT FOR <br />ROUNDTAIL CHUB, BLUEHEAD SUCKER, AND <br />FLANNELMOUTH SUCKER <br />I. INTRODUCTION <br />This Conservation Agreement (Agreement) has been developed to expedite <br />~ implementation of conservation measures for roundtail chub (Gila robusta), bluehead sucker <br />(Catostomus discobolus), and flannelmouth sucker (Catostomus latipinnis), hereinafter referred <br />to as the three species, throughout their respective ranges as a collaborative and cooperative <br />effort among resource agencies. Threats that warrant the three species being listed as sensitive <br />~ by state and federal agencies and that might lead to listing by the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service <br />as threatened or endangered under the Endangered Species Act of 1973, as amended (ESA), <br />should be minimized through implementation of this Agreement. Additional state, federal, and <br />~i tribal partners in this effort are welcomed, and such participation (as signatories or otherwise) is <br />hereby solicited. <br />II. GOAL <br />r The goal of this agreement is to ensure the persistence of roundtail chub, bluehead <br />sucker, and flannelmouth sucker populations throughout their ranges. <br /> <br />III. OBJECTIVES <br />The individual state's signatory to this document will develop conservation and <br />3 <br />management plans for any or all of the three species that occur naturally within their state. Any <br />future signatories may also choose to develop individual conservation and management plans, or <br />~ to integrate their efforts with existing plans.
